U-19 Women’s Cricket team leaves for Kuwait

January 30, 2012
in Uncategorized
Reading Time: 1 min read
0
0
SHARES
17
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

The Under 19 Women’s Cricket team left for Kuwait to participate in the Asian Cricket Council U-19 Women’s Championship for 2012 today. This is the third time Bhutan’s team is participating in the ACC championship.

Bhutan is placed in group B along with Hong Kong, Qatar and Kuwait. The first match will be played against Hong Kong on February 3, followed by Kuwait and Qatar on February 4and February 5.

A total of nine countries are participating in the Championship. The finals will be played on February 10.
